    The headlines on Al-Jazeera’s website on March 9, 2007 were unexpected and powerful: "Saddam Judge Flees Iraq." Raouf Abdel-Rhaman, the judge who sentenced Saddam Hussein, as well as Barzan al-Tikriti and Awad al-Bandar, to death, has left Iraq and has applied for political asylum in Great Britain.
